The Argos are going to place quarterback James Franklin on the six-game injured list.

Franklin completed 20-of-28 passes for 224 yards with two picks and a touchdown in the Week 3 loss to the Riders. During the fourth quarter, Franklin hobbled to the sidelines with five minutes remaining favouring his right leg after being sacked.
Franklin finished last season with a 2-6 win-loss record, throwing for 2,034 yards, eight touchdowns against nine interceptions while rushing 78 times for 365 yards and 14 touchdowns. He’s off to an 0-2 start in 2019 as the No. 1 pivot.
McLeod Bethel-Thompson came into the game in Regina and hit on 3-of-6 passes for 50 yards against Saskatchewan. He could get his first start of the season at home versus B.C.
Bethel-Thompson takes over as the starter. He went 2-6 eight starts last season completing 65 per cent of his passes for 2,007 yards with nine touchdowns and nine interceptions during those outings.
